description Product Description
(S)-3-Ethylmorpholine hydrochloride is widely used in the pharmaceutical industry as a chiral building block for the synthesis of various active pharmaceutical ingredients (APIs). Its enantiomeric purity makes it valuable in the development of drugs that require specific stereochemistry for efficacy, particularly in central nervous system (CNS) therapies and pain management medications. Additionally, it serves as an intermediate in the production of agrochemicals, contributing to the creation of pesticides and herbicides with enhanced activity and selectivity. The compound is also utilized in organic synthesis for the preparation of complex molecules, where its morpholine ring structure acts as a key functional group. Its hydrochloride form ensures improved solubility and stability, making it suitable for various chemical reactions and formulations.
